Sintered stone is a stone-based material, which can be crafted to resemble other materials, ranging from wood to natural stones and other common features but with all the characteristics of a porcelain panel, including stain resistance, durability, low-maintenance, scratch resistance, fire resistance, and recyclability. The name comes from sintering, which is the process of fusing materials into a solid piece by heating with high temperature.
